Default Service active handling

Sorry bout all the questions guys. Thanks in advance for the help

I just got my car back from dealer for having the sensor in the steering wheel replaced cuz it kept locking down the car while I was driving. It's an 05 a4

This morning I get in the car and the "service active handling" is flashing all over the dash. Am I having more issues with the active handling? Once I cut the car off and turned it back ok it went away..... Is it gonna come back?

Ask your dealer to check the GM technical bulletin on this issue. There is a small plastic clip they can install inside the steering column to eliminate the problem. Takes about 20 minutes to perform.

I had the same thing happen. The second fix seems to be working. The part cost is about $10-$15 and whatever labor is for a 15-20 minute job. Not too expensive. However, I told the service manager I didn't want them to do a computer analysis to determine the problem...Just do the tech. bulletin fix. That probably saved me $60.

Best to get it fixed, and if it just needs the clip it won't take long to do or cost much, and then it should be fixed for good. I guess it's your choice whether you want the mechanic to check for codes or merely perform the TSB. In my case, I was fairly certain the TSB fix would work, so I just told them to do it. It worked!

The TSB is (or was, may have been updated) bulletin 06-02-35-002.
